As of 2026-04-01, HF Sinclair Corporation (DINO) trades at a current price of $60.92, representing a 2.36% decline in recent sessions. This analysis outlines key technical levels, prevailing market context for the downstream energy firm, and potential scenarios for price action in the near term. DINO operates across refining, renewable fuels, and fuel marketing segments, making its performance closely tied to energy sector dynamics and consumer fuel demand trends.
